How to Check Your Emirates Flight Status

Checking your Emirates flight status is easier than you might think! Emirates offers several convenient methods to keep you informed about your flight from Dubai (DXB) to Hyderabad (HYD). Let's explore these options in detail:

1. Emirates Official Website

The Emirates official website is your primary source for the most accurate and up-to-date information. Here’s how to use it:

  • Visit the Emirates Website: Go to www.emirates.com.
  • Navigate to Flight Status: Look for the "Flight Status" or "Manage Booking" section. This is usually prominently displayed on the homepage.
  • Enter Flight Details: You'll need to enter either the flight number (e.g., EK 524) or the origin and destination cities along with the date of travel.
  • View Real-Time Updates: Once you enter the information, the website will display the current status of your flight, including departure and arrival times, gate information, and any delays.

2. Emirates Mobile App

For those who prefer to stay updated on the go, the Emirates mobile app is a fantastic option. Available for both iOS and Android devices, the app provides real-time flight status updates and a host of other features.

  • Download and Install: Get the Emirates app from the App Store or Google Play Store.
  • Login or Continue as Guest: You can log in with your Emirates Skywards account or continue as a guest.
  • Access Flight Status: Find the "Flight Status" section on the app’s main menu.
  • Enter Flight Details: Input your flight number or origin and destination details.
  • Receive Notifications: Enable push notifications to receive instant alerts about any changes to your flight schedule, gate information, or delays.

The Emirates app is incredibly convenient for travelers. Its push notification feature ensures you are immediately informed of any changes, allowing you to adjust your plans accordingly. Beyond flight status, the app also offers features like mobile check-in, digital boarding passes, and access to your Emirates Skywards account. 3. Third-Party Flight Tracking Websites

Third-party flight tracking websites are also a viable option for monitoring your Emirates flight from Dubai to Hyderabad. These websites aggregate flight information from various sources, providing a comprehensive overview of flight statuses worldwide.

  • Popular Websites: Some reliable options include FlightAware, FlightStats, and Google Flights.
  • Enter Flight Details: Simply enter your Emirates flight number (e.g., EK 524) or the origin and destination cities (Dubai to Hyderabad) and the date of travel.
  • View Flight Status: The website will display the current status of your flight, including real-time location, estimated arrival time, and any reported delays.

While these websites can be useful, it's essential to verify the information with the official Emirates channels to ensure accuracy. Third-party sites rely on data feeds from various sources, which may sometimes be delayed or inaccurate. Understanding Flight Status Information

When checking your Emirates flight status, you'll encounter various terms and codes. Understanding these will help you interpret the information accurately:

  • Scheduled: The flight is on schedule according to the original timetable.
  • Delayed: The flight is delayed, and the estimated departure or arrival time will be provided.
  • Cancelled: The flight has been cancelled. Contact Emirates for rebooking options.
  • Departed: The flight has left the gate.
  • Arrived: The flight has landed at its destination.
  • Gate Information: The gate number for departure or arrival.

Familiarizing yourself with these terms ensures that you can quickly understand the status of your flight. Delays can be caused by various factors, including weather conditions, air traffic control, or technical issues. If your flight is delayed or canceled, Emirates will typically provide assistance with rebooking and accommodation if necessary. Factors That Can Affect Flight Status

Several factors can affect the status of your Emirates flight from Dubai to Hyderabad. Being aware of these can help you anticipate potential disruptions:

  • Weather Conditions: Severe weather, such as thunderstorms, heavy rain, or fog, can cause delays or cancellations.
  • Air Traffic Control: Congestion in the airspace can lead to delays.
  • Technical Issues: Mechanical problems with the aircraft can also result in delays.
  • Airport Congestion: High traffic at the airport can cause delays in departure and arrival.
  • Geopolitical Issues: Unexpected events or security concerns can also impact flight schedules.

Understanding these factors can help you manage your expectations and plan accordingly. Airlines prioritize safety, so delays due to weather or technical issues are often unavoidable. Air traffic control manages the flow of aircraft to ensure safe and efficient operations, which can sometimes result in delays during peak travel times. Tips for a Smooth Flight from Dubai to Hyderabad

To ensure a smooth flight from Dubai to Hyderabad with Emirates, here are some practical tips to keep in mind:

  • Check in Online: Check in online 24 hours before your flight to save time at the airport.
  • Arrive Early: Arrive at the airport at least 3 hours before your scheduled departure time.
  • Pack Smart: Pack essential items in your carry-on luggage, such as medication and valuables.
  • Stay Hydrated: Drink plenty of water during the flight to stay hydrated.
  • Stay Updated: Monitor your flight status regularly for any changes or delays.

Following these tips can significantly enhance your travel experience. Online check-in allows you to select your seat and avoid long queues at the airport. Arriving early gives you ample time to clear security and immigration, reducing stress. Packing smart ensures that you have everything you need within easy reach during the flight. Staying hydrated is crucial for your well-being, especially on long flights. Regularly monitoring your flight status ensures that you are aware of any changes and can adjust your plans accordingly.
